    The Aftermath and Kidman’s Life Today

    Despite the hardships, Kidman seems to have recovered. Her career experienced an all-time high after her divorce, and she received several Academy Award nominations for her performances in 2011’s Rabbit Hole and 2017’s The Lion. The actress appears to be thriving in her personal life as well. In 2006 she married New-Zealand born country singer Keith Urban.

    The couple seems to have quite the successful relationship. Barely two years after getting married, Kidman gave birth to two girls. The first daughter, Sunday Rose Kidman Urban was born in 2008. The second, Faith Margaret Kidman Rose was born in 2010 via a surrogate. As for the adopted children she has with Cruise, Kidman has expressed her unconditional love for them. Though both children, now adults, don’t associate with their mother, the actress still claims that she will always be there for them.

    In an interview with the Australian magazine, Who, she said: “No matter what your child does, the child has love, and the child has to know there is available love and I’m open here. I think that’s so important because if that is taken away from a child, to sever that in any child, in any relationship, in any family — I believe it’s wrong. So that’s our job as a parent, to always offer unconditional love.”
